Roasted Red Pepper Hummus Recipe

1 15-oz can of garbanzo beans, drained
2 roasted red peppers, sliced (I used the canned kind)
1/4 cup tahini (pureed sesame seeds - I found it next to the pickles at the grocery store)
3 tablespoons lemon juice (I used fresh lemon juice)
1 clove garlic, chopped
1 tablespoon extra virgin olive oil
1/2 teaspoon ground cumin
1/2 teaspoon cayenne pepper
salt - to taste
Pour all ingredients into a blender or food processor. Blend until it reaches your desired consistency. If you want it thinner, you can reserve the juice from your garbanzo beans and add it to the mixture....
